How to simulate a subsystem by EnergyPlus

I would like to simulate a part of HVAC system (i.e. subsystem) such as;

  1. Heat source subsystem, including chillers/heatpumps and chilled water pumps
  2. Condenser water subsystem, including chillers, condenser water pumps, and cooling towers, and
  3. Air distribution subsystem, including VAVs/CAVs and AHUs/FCUs.

The purpose is to understand how the subsystems work and to investigate the system characteristics against some changes in boundary conditions and control parameters as BESTEST does. Thus, my question is how to input boundary conditions (cooling/heating load and/or flow rate or temperature) to separate the subsystems.

I know that LoadProfile:Plant can be one of the solutions, but it seems that it can only be used for heat source subsystems.

Is there any way to simulate subsystems by EnergyPlus?
